Some people are sensitive to aspartame, but unless you have a very specific metabolic disorder, it’s quite safe. In fact, because of the controversies surrounding it, it is probably the most studied artificial sweetener. There’s over 40 years of data for it, and if you instead use saccharin, over 100 years.
 
Also, the FDA isn’t shy about banning artificial sweeteners (see cyclamate, which has been banned and unbanned in other countries a few times). There are many to choose from and all are cheaper than real sugar, so if any data actually points towards danger they pull the plug pretty quickly. There IS evidence of saccharin causing bladder cancer in rats, however there’s no evidence that it affects humans similarly (and, again, >100 years of human data). Rats have different urine conditions, which seems to account for it. Rodent models are not that great for a lot of things, actually…
 
There’s nothing wrong with avoiding it, though.
